The 70th wave of retaliatory strikes against US and Israeli interests in the Gulf region and beyond targeted more than 55 locations, according to Iran’s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C).
In a statement published by Iran’s English-language Press TV website, the IRGC described the latest wave of attacks as resulting in “loud explosions, bursts of fire, and columns of smoke” throughout the targeted areas.
Several countries in the region, including Saudi Arabia, Kuwait and Israel, reported deploying air defence systems to intercept attacks involving drones and missiles early on Saturday.
Reports also emerged that Iran launched at least two mid-range ballistic missiles targeting the joint US-UK military base in the Indian Ocean island of Diego Garcia.
